## XLSX (Binary Spreadsheet Endpoints)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
XLSX is the world's most popular binary spreadsheet format. [Tim Allen][flipperpa] of [The Wharton School][wharton] maintains [drf-renderer-xlsx][drf-renderer-xlsx], which renders an endpoint as an XLSX spreadsheet using OpenPyXL, and allows the client to download it. Spreadsheets can be styled on a per-view basis.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
#### Installation & configuration
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Install using pip.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
$ pip install drf-renderer-xlsx
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Modify your REST framework settings.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
REST_FRAMEWORK = {
|
||||||
|
...
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
'DEFAULT_RENDERER_CLASSES': (
|
||||||
|
'rest_framework.renderers.JSONRenderer',
|
||||||
|
'rest_framework.renderers.BrowsableAPIRenderer',
|
||||||
|
'drf_renderer_xlsx.renderers.XLSXRenderer',
|
||||||
|
),
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
To avoid having a file streamed without a filename (which the browser will often default to the filename "download", with no extension), we need to use a mixin to override the `Content-Disposition` header. If no filename is provided, it will default to `export.xlsx`. For example: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
from rest_framework.viewsets import ReadOnlyModelViewSet
|
||||||
|
from drf_renderer_xlsx.mixins import XLSXFileMixin
|
||||||
|
from drf_renderer_xlsx.renderers import XLSXRenderer
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
from .models import MyExampleModel
|
||||||
|
from .serializers import MyExampleSerializer
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
class MyExampleViewSet(XLSXFileMixin, ReadOnlyModelViewSet):
|
||||||
|
queryset = MyExampleModel.objects.all()
|
||||||
|
serializer_class = MyExampleSerializer
|
||||||
|
renderer_classes = (XLSXRenderer,)
|
||||||
|
filename = 'my_export.xlsx'
